Training and information sessions

In partnership with PHX Training, the team recently offered tenants in South Ribble the opportunity to attend some free training and information sessions around calculating energy bills, cooking on a budget and employability support.

We are in the process of setting up similar courses in the Fylde area so watch this space for more information.

We are also working with a new training provider to set up a 2-week CSCS course and 2-week Level 1 Business Admin and IT course in the coming months.

Digital Skills Workshops

Running fortnightly (1st and 3rd Thursday of the month) at The Place Community Centre, Royal Avenue, Leyland from 1pm to 2.30pm.

We can help you with:

  • Learning the basics about a computer
  • Getting online, including how to send emails
  • Building digital skills
  • Improving your knowledge on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Microsoft Teams etc

The workshops are free to attend, and everyone is welcome.  Access to Wi-Fi, and refreshments will be available.  

Job Clubs 

Progress Futures job clubs are held on a weekly basis, are free to attend and open to all members of the community.  

We offer access to laptops, Wi-Fi, tea, coffee and support from the team should you need it. 

  • Tuesdays - 10am to 12pm - The Paddock Room, South Ribble Council Offices, West Paddock, PR25 1DH
  • Wednesdays - 10am to 12pm - The Place Community Centre, Royal Avenue, PR25 1BX
  • Thursdays - 10am to 12pm - The Base on Broadfield II Community Centre, Bannister Drive, Leyland, PR25 2GD
  • Fortnightly Fridays - 9.30am to 11.30am (1st & 3rd Friday – starting 7 February) - Christian Community Larder, St Aidan’s Community Hub, Station Road, Bamber Bridge, PR5 6QR
  • Last Friday of every month - 10am to 12pm - Kirkham Family Hub and The Zone, Chapel Walks, Kirkham, PR4 2TA

New Year, New You event

The team held a 'New Year, New You' event at The Base II Community Centre in February. Tenants were invited to attend to discuss upcoming training sessions and workshops, and get support on creating and updating CVs and exploring employment and volunteering opportunities.

Colleagues from Runshaw College also attended to provide tenants with information regarding apprenticeship and adult education courses.
